    I did the Becker Final Test two, and there were some questions on the sims for ratios. The question did not specify that I had to round so I just plugged in the formula directly into the cell, and the answer came out to have over 10 decimal places. I got the answers wrong because of this. The Becker solution shows that there should be only two decimal places.

    I am sure that on the real exam it will say how many decimal places to round to, so how do I set the formula so that it is only 2 decimal places. For example if you enter =1/3, it will be .3333333. How do I make it so that it is already rounded.

    Also if i just enter the answer manually without using the formula, will I get points deducted?

    I don't think you can change this on the exam calculator. However, you can double check by playing around with the calculator in the sample exam on the AICPA website. Just use your basic rounding rules (they do still teach this I hope!). Anything less than 5 round down and anything above 5 round up. .33333 to 2 decimals is just .33. .2983823 would round to .30.
